QS-326 is a super-spreading silicone surfactant based on polyether-modified trisiloxane. It is a spray adjuvant that reduces the surface tension of the spray solution, thereby increasing spray coverage. It also reduces foam in the mixture.

Product Description:

QS-326 is a low-foam super spreader, suitable for foliar spraying of herbicides, insecticides, fungicides and other pesticides. Also called polyether modified trisiloxane surfactant.

This spray adjuvant is more effective than traditional spray adjuvants in helping to reduce water-based surface tension.

It has ultra-extreme spreading and penetrating , Lower surface tension which reduces the contact angle of the spray solution on the leaf surface, thereby increasing the spray coverage.


Chemical name: Polyalkylene modified heptamethyltrisiloxane

CAS No. 27306-78-1
Active content percent 99.8%
Appearance Clear, little yellow liquid
Cloud Point(0.1 wt%) <10°C
Refractive index at 25°C 1.435-1.445
Freezing point < 2°C
Viscosity at 25°C(77°CF) 10-60cSt
Surface tension(0.1% aq.) 19.5-22mN/m
